WebFor decedents dying in 2012, the exclusion amount is $5.12 million. This means that the first $5.12 million of a person's assets are free from federal estate tax. Assets over and above this amount are taxed at the rate of 35% (in 2012). ... Gifts that exceed the annual exclusion amount and the estate tax exclusion amount are subject to gift tax ... WebApr 28, 2024 · The federal government imposes a tax on gifts. However, as the law does not concern itself with trifles [1] Congress has permitted donors to give a “small” amount to each beneficiary of their choosing before facing the federal gift tax.
